The Evolution of Printing Technologies for Clothes Labels

The technology behind printer for clothes labels has advanced significantly over recent years. From traditional thermal and screen printing methods to cutting-edge digital solutions, industry professionals now have a wide array of options to meet their specific requirements.

Traditional Printing Methods

Earlier methods like screen printing and thermal transfer were common but had limitations in customization, color vibrancy, and efficiency. While suitable for mass production, these methods often lacked the flexibility needed for smaller runs, complex designs, or quick turnaround times.

Digital Printing Technologies

The emergence of digital printers for clothes labels has revolutionized the industry. These printers enable high-resolution, full-color outputs on various label materials, providing unmatched flexibility, efficiency, and quality. Technologies like UV printing, inkjet, and thermal sublimation have become popular for their capacity to produce detailed images and withstand washing and wear.

Types of Printers Suitable for Clothes Labels

Depending on your production scale and label complexity, different types of printers may best suit your needs:

  • Desktop Inkjet Printers: Compact and cost-effective, ideal for small businesses or custom labels.
  • Industrial Digital Printers: Designed for high-volume production with superior speed and durability.
  • Thermal Transfer Printers: Excellent for producing durable, long-lasting labels with resistance to washing.
  • UV Printers: Capable of printing on textured or synthetic surfaces with excellent adhesion and durability.

Key Considerations for Choosing the Perfect Printer for Clothes Labels

When selecting a printer for clothes labels, focus on the following critical factors:

Print Resolution and Color Fidelity

High-resolution printers (at least 600 dpi) ensure crisp images and text, vital for logos, intricate designs, or multicolored artwork. Accurate color reproduction is essential to match your brand palette.

Material Compatibility and Versatility

Choose a printer capable of printing on different label materials such as polyester, satin, or woven labels. Versatility allows you to diversify your offerings and adapt to market demands.

Durability and Resistance

Labels should survive multiple washes, friction, and environmental conditions. UV-resistant or waterproof inks are crucial to maintain label integrity over time.

Production Speed

Speed is critical, especially when scaling production. Industrial printers can produce hundreds or thousands of labels daily, enabling faster order fulfillment.

Ease of Operation and Maintenance

An intuitive user interface and straightforward maintenance reduce downtime, training costs, and operational errors.

How to Integrate a Printer for Clothes Labels into Your Business Workflow

Integration involves more than just purchasing a machine. Follow these steps for seamless implementation:

  1. Assess your production volume and design complexity: Select a printer matching your current and projected needs.
  2. Choose compatible label materials: Based on product specifications and branding strategy.
  3. Set up your digital design process: Use professional software to create vector-based labels ready for printing.
  4. Train your staff: Ensure they understand machine operation,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
  5. Establish quality control procedures: Regularly check color accuracy, registration, and adhesion.
  6. Scale gradually: Start with small batches, refine processes, and expand capacity as needed.

Future Trends in Clothes Labels Printing Technology

The industry continues to evolve with innovations that can further enhance your business:

  • Eco-friendly inks and substrates: Reducing environmental impact and appealing to eco-conscious consumers.
  • Smart labels: Incorporating QR codes, RFID, or NFC chips for interactive branding and supply chain management.
  • On-demand and personalized printing: Offering bespoke labels for limited editions or customization.
  • Automation integration: Linking printers with production lines for streamlined workflow.
